Before
Operating
Your Dryer
Readyour
Owner's Guide. It has important safety
and warranty information. It also has many
suggestions for best drying results.
To reduce the risk of fire, electric
shock, or injury to persons, read the IMPORTANT
SAFETYINSTRUCTIONSin your owner's guide before
operating this appliance.
Operating
Steps
Read Drying Procedures in your Owner's Guide.
It explains these operating steps in detail.
1. Prepare items for drying.
2. Check that lint screen is dean and in place.
3. Load the dryer. If desired, add a dryer fabric
softener sheet.
4. Close the dryer door.
5. Set Drying Temperature
control
6. Turn cycle selector dockwise
to desired
setting.
7. Start dryer. Turn the Turn to Start control
clockwise to ON. Hold for 1-2 seconds and
release.
8. A signal will sound when the cycle ends.
9. Remove items immediately
and hang or
fold.
10. Clean lint screen after every load.
Temperature
Selection
Always
follow
directions
on fabric
care
labels.
To avoid fire hazard, do not use heat
to dry items containing feathers or down, foam
rubber, plastics, or similarly textured, rubber-like
materials. Use Air Fluff-No Heat cycle only.
Select the temperature setting most suitable for each
load The REGULAR--HIGH HEA T, PERM PRESS--
MEDIUM HEA T, KNITS--MEDIUM-LO
W HEA Tan d
DELICATES--LOWHEATtemperature
settings may
be used with any cycle setting.
Cycle Selection
Turn cycle selector clockwise to desired cycle and
setting.
The Automatic and Timed Dry cycles end with a cool
down period. The heat automatically turns off and
the load continues to tumble during the cool down
period. This reduces wrinkling and makes items
easier to handle during unloading.
Drying time varies depending on size and dampness
of load, weight and fabric type. Room temperature
and humidity, type of installation and electrical
voltage or gas pressure can also affect drying time.
